Don't like pasta? Then order this, Risotto Pollo. Rice cooked with herbs and slices of chicken. The rice is soft, smells of nice pepper, you'll love it. RM 13.80.
Well, if you are thinking of pizza, try this common one, Pizza Hawaiian Chicken. Different from the fast food kind of pizza, the pizza crust is thinner, harder, which is the typical Italian kind of pizza crust. Cheesy, sweet sour taste of pineapple and chicken available at RM 16.80.
Or you can try the Salmone Pizza. Instead of chicken, smoked salmon slices and tuna are used as the toppings. Yummy! RM 25.80.
An Italian meal cannot be 'complete' without the Tiramisu. The cake texture is soft, with cocco powder on top. Not too creamy, just nice for dessert.
